All Rights Reserved. */ package org.netbeans.test.editor.app.core; import org.netbeans.test.editor.app.gui.*; import javax.swing.JEditorPane; import java.awt.event.KeyEvent; import javax.swing.text.Keymap; import javax.swing.KeyStroke; import javax.swing.Action; import java.awt.event.ActionEvent; import java.util.*; import java.awt.event.*; import org.netbeans.modules.editor.NbEditorDocument; import javax.swing.text.EditorKit; import javax.swing.plaf.TextUI; import org.netbeans.editor.Utilities; import org.netbeans.editor.ext.Completion; import org.netbeans.editor.ext.ExtEditorUI; import org.netbeans.test.editor.app.Main; /** * * @author pnejedly * @version */ public class EventLoggingEditorPane extends JEditorPane { private Logger logger=null; public Hashtable namesToActions; private Action[] actions; /** Creates new EventLoggingEditorPane */ public EventLoggingEditorPane() { super(); } public String[] getActionsNames() { Action[] as = getEditorKit().getActions(); String[] ret; ret=new String[as.length]; for( int i=0; i < as.length; i++ ) ret[i]=(String)(actions[i].getValue( Action.NAME )); return ret; } public void setLogger(Logger log) { logger = log; } public Completion getCompletion() { return ((ExtEditorUI)(Utilities.getEditorUI(Main.frame.getEditor()))).getCompletion(); } private final boolean myMapEventToAction(KeyEvent e) { Keymap binding = getKeymap(); Completion comp=((ExtEditorUI)(Utilities.getEditorUI(this))).getCompletion(); if (comp.isPaneVisible()) { KeyStroke kst=KeyStroke.getKeyStroke(e.getKeyCode(),e.getModifiers(),false); if (logger != null) { String com=(String)(comp.getJDCPopupPanel().getInputMap().get(kst)); if (com != null) { logger.logCompletionAction(com); return true; } } } if (binding != null) { KeyStroke k = KeyStroke.getKeyStrokeForEvent(e); Action a = binding.getAction(k); if (a != null) { String command = null; if (e.getKeyChar() != KeyEvent.CHAR_UNDEFINED) { command = String.valueOf(e.getKeyChar()); } ActionEvent ae = new ActionEvent(this, ActionEvent.ACTION_PERFORMED,command, e.getModifiers()); if (logger != null) logger.logAction( a, ae ); a.actionPerformed(ae); e.consume(); return true; } } return false; } protected void processComponentKeyEvent(KeyEvent e) { int id = e.getID(); switch(id) { case KeyEvent.KEY_TYPED: if (myMapEventToAction(e) == false) { // default behavior is to input translated // characters as content if the character // hasn't been mapped in the keymap. Keymap binding = getKeymap(); if (binding != null) { Action a = binding.getDefaultAction(); if (a != null) { ActionEvent ae = new ActionEvent(this, ActionEvent.ACTION_PERFORMED, String.valueOf(e.getKeyChar()), e.getModifiers()); if (logger != null) logger.logAction( a, ae ); a.actionPerformed(ae); e.consume(); } } } break; case KeyEvent.KEY_PRESSED: myMapEventToAction(e); break; case KeyEvent.KEY_RELEASED: myMapEventToAction(e); break; } } public Action[] getActions() { if (actions == null) return new Action[0]; return actions; } private void poorSetEditorKit(int index) { EditorKit kit = getEditorKitForContentType(TestSetKitAction.kitsTypes[index]); setDocument(new NbEditorDocument(kit.getClass())); super.setEditorKit(kit); actions = null; } public void setEditorKit(int index) { poorSetEditorKit(index); System.err.println("Starting kit setting."); actions = getEditorKit().getActions(); namesToActions = new Hashtable( actions.length ); // prepare hashtable for them and fill it with all actions for( int i=0; i < actions.length; i++ ) namesToActions.put( actions[i].getValue( Action.NAME ), actions[i] ); System.err.println("Ending kit setting."); } public void perform(final java.awt.event.ActionEvent p1) { Action a = (Action)namesToActions.get((String)(p1.getActionCommand())); if (logger != null) logger.logAction( a, p1 ); a.actionPerformed(p1); } } |
